Understanding Cyber Law in Healthcare
Cyber law refers to the legal framework that governs digital activities, including data protection, online transactions, and electronic communication. In healthcare, cyber law plays a critical role in safeguarding sensitive patient information.
Clinics handle confidential data such as:
Patient medical records
Diagnostic reports
Prescription details
Personal identification information

Legal Framework Governing Cyber Law in India
Delhi clinics must comply with several legal provisions related to cyber law:
Information Technology Act, 2000
Data protection and privacy guidelines
Telemedicine Practice Guidelines

Data Protection and Patient Confidentiality
Maintaining patient confidentiality is a fundamental principle of medical ethics. In the digital age, this extends to protecting electronic data.
Best Practices Include:
Using secure software for patient records
Encrypting sensitive information
Limiting access to authorized staff
Avoiding sharing data on unsecured platforms

Secure Use of Telemedicine Platforms
Telemedicine has become a vital part of healthcare delivery. However, it also raises concerns about data security and legal compliance.
Doctors Must Ensure:
Use of authorized and secure platforms
Proper patient consent before consultation
Clear documentation of interactions
Safe storage of digital prescriptions

Handling Data Breaches and Cyber Incidents
Despite best efforts, cyber incidents can occur. Clinics must be prepared to respond quickly and effectively.
Steps to Take:
Identify and contain the breach
Inform affected patients
Report the incident to authorities
Seek legal assistance

Common Cyber Law Mistakes Doctors Must Avoid
Many clinics unknowingly violate cyber laws. Here are common mistakes:
Using unsecured messaging apps for consultations
Sharing patient data without consent
Not updating software or security systems
Ignoring data backup practices
